Abstract (Document Summary)
William Lucas, a CSUMB student who said he will receive his diploma in May, sat on the carpeted floor of the administrative building holding a sign that read, "Free, Accessible and Quality Education For All Students!" Lucas transferred from the community college system to CSUMB in 2008 as a linguistics major, but said he was forced to change his major to entrepreneurial business because of the lack of language class offerings. Faculty leaders say the cuts threaten to reduce student access to the CSU -- a key educational institution which serves large numbers of low-income students, many of whom are the first in their families to attend college.\n
